What is Double Glazing?

Double glazing includes making use of two panes of glass separated by an area filled with air or gas. This style creates an insulating barrier that reduces heat transfer, making homes warmer in winter and cooler in summer. The advantages of double glazing extend beyond thermal efficiency; they likewise include increased security and improved soundproofing.

Secret Components of Double Glazed Windows

ElementDescription
Glass Panes2 sheets of glass (generally 4 mm thick)
Spacer BarsMetal or composite materials separating the glass
Gas FillingArgon or krypton gas to improve insulation
Frame MaterialsWood, PVC-u, or aluminum for structural support

Advantages of Double Glazing Renovation

Integrating double glazing into home remodelling uses various advantages, turning the option into a worthwhile financial investment. Below are a few of the primary advantages:

  1. Energy Efficiency

    • Decreased energy bills due to less dependence on heating and cooling systems.
    • Improved insulation preserves a comfortable indoor temperature.
  2. Noise Reduction

    • Improved acoustic properties lessen outside noise.
    • Perfect for homes located in hectic metropolitan areas.
  3. Increased Home Value

    • Appealing function for potential buyers.
    • Greater energy performance ratings enhance marketability.
  4. UV Protection

    • Reduces fading of furniture and décor triggered by ultraviolet light.
    • Protective finishes can further boost UV filtering.
  5. Enhanced Security

    • Double-glazed windows are more difficult to break, providing much better security against break-ins.
    • Lots of designs included multi-point locking systems for additional security.

Aspects to Consider Before Renovating

When considering a double glazing remodelling, numerous factors should be assessed to make sure a seamless upgrade:

1. Kind of Glazing

Double glazing can come in different kinds, including:

  • Standard double glazing: Basic two-pane setup.
  • Low-emissivity (Low-E) glazing: Features an unique covering to increase thermal efficiency.

2. Frame Material

The product of the window frame plays an essential function:

  • uPVC: Durable and maintenance-free, excellent heat retention.
  • Wood: Aesthetic appeal however needs maintenance.
  • Aluminum: Sturdy, contemporary look, but less insulated than uPVC.

3. Budget plan

The restoration cost differs based upon window size, type of frame, and setup complexity. It's essential to acquire price quotes and think about financing choices if needed.

4. Setup Process

Selecting the ideal contractor or DIY can affect the setup result. Homeowners must examine:

  • Experience and reputation of specialists.
  • Timespan for setup.
  • Guarantee and aftercare services provided.

The Renovation Process

A common double glazing renovation follows a structured process that guarantees efficient execution and very little disruption. Below is an overview of the steps involved:

  1. Assessment: Evaluate current windows and determine the practicality of an upgrade.
  2. Selection: Choose proper glazing type and frame material.
  3. Preparation: Clear the area around windows; guarantee structural integrity if needed.
  4. Setup: Remove old windows and install brand-new double-glazed units.
  5. Ending up Touches: Inspect for air leaks, use touch-ups, and clean the workspace.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. For how long does it take to install double glazing?

Setup can generally take a few hours to a day, depending on the variety of windows and the intricacy of the task.

2. How much does double glazing restoration cost?

Expenses can vary commonly depending upon size, design, and product. On average, property owners might spend in between ₤ 400 and ₤ 1000 per window.

3. Will double glazing remove all noise?

While double glazing substantially lowers noise levels, it might not get rid of all noises. The degree of sound reduction depends upon elements such as the kind of glazing and the surrounding environment.

4. Can I install double glazing myself?

While skilled DIYers can attempt setup, it is highly suggested to employ professionals to guarantee quality and compliance with building regulations.

5. The length of time does double glazing last?

High-quality double glazing units can last 20 years or more with correct maintenance and care.
